Transaction 59ea521316e3e084502467802c16c16fd8b0be69d98d6fd9a030710818883671
1 Input
2 Outputs
- 59ea521316e3e084502467802c16c16fd8b0be69d98d6fd9a030710818883671:0
- 59ea521316e3e084502467802c16c16fd8b0be69d98d6fd9a030710818883671:1
value 3703000
address 12PeCCTdb47UpV6tvLzd2VDjrPKPsUZbFJ
value 325381943
address 1Mr8o1Dc1i2h2UdmYwHGVqFY4423H91tJc